128,666,272 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.
128666272 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seventy-two divisors.
Prime factorization of 128666272:
25 × 7 × 292 × 683
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 29 × 29 × 683)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 128666272 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 128666272
Divisors of 128666272
- Number of divisors d(n): 72
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 4 7 8 14 16 28 29 32 56 58 112 116 203 224 232 406 464 683 812 841 928 1366 1624 1682 2732 3248 3364 4781 5464 5887 6496 6728 9562 10928 11774 13456 19124 19807 21856 23548 26912 38248 39614 47096 76496 79228 94192 138649 152992 158456 188384 277298 316912 554596 574403 633824 1109192 1148806 2218384 2297612 4020821 4436768 4595224 8041642 9190448 16083284 18380896 32166568 64333136 128666272
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 300265056
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 171598784
- 128666272 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(171598784)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 42932512
